Subject: Rate-parity checker cut-over complete

Team — Parityscope is now fully cut over to the new crawler fleet. Old pollers are drained and disabled. Mismatch alerts resumed at 09:00 with no backlog. One retry-storm during warm-up; throttle fix merged. Please review the production settings we landed with, listed below.

config for kafof-bawef:
holath:
  log_level: debug
  metrics_host: metrics.holath.qorvelsys.internal
  pin: 2191
  pool_size: 32

It fetches third-party RSS/Atom feeds, parses enclosure metadata, and flags malformed or oversized entries before they reach the ingestion pipeline. Fetching runs inside an isolated worker pool with outbound traffic restricted to an allowlist; parsed XML is handled by a hardened parser with external entities disabled. Audit logs for every fetch are retained for ninety days. Threat model notes and prior review findings are in the security wiki. Questions during your review should go to the service owner at the address below.

escalation mailbox, bafog-fafog: ulador@paliqlabs.internal

**Finance Review – Support Outsourcing Plan**

Heads up, all: the numbers on outsourcing tier-one support to Bramlow Services look decent. We'd save roughly 18% annually against current staffing costs, even after transition expenses. Quality risk is the open question — pilot metrics land next month. Nothing's signed yet, so keep this within this group. There's one confidential consideration attached below for your eyes only.

management briefing: Project Ulavan slips by two quarters because of the staffing delay.

**Handover: Stockweave reconciliation job — from Darja to Petrin**

Quick notes for whoever picks this up. The Stockweave job reconciles warehouse counts against the Ledgerby catalog nightly at 02:15. It's idempotent; safe to rerun. Known quirk: the Ostmark depot feed sometimes lags an hour, so a single-night mismatch there is usually noise. Escalate only after two consecutive failures. Logs land in the usual place under `stockweave/recon`. Don't touch the batch size without load-testing first. Current job configuration for reference:

deployment values, kajep-kageg:
[praix]
host = praix.paliqcorp.corp
user = praix_svc
database = praix_prod